Limerick teenager John Ryan has signed for English League One club Reading FC
A TALENTED Limerick teenager has joined English EFL League One club Reading FC.
Nineteen-year-old John Ryan has signed a one-year deal with Reading's U21 side who are managed by former Republic of Ireland international Noel Hunt.
Republic of Ireland under-age international Ryan had been a free agent since leaving Serie A side Sassuolo in Italy over the summer, and impressed during a trial period at Reading including when featuring for the first-team in a pre-season game with Queens Park Rangers.
The versatile Ryan moved to Serie A top flight Sassuolo from UCD who were playing in the SSE Airtricity League Premier Division 12 months ago. Ryan had joined UCD from Shamrock Rovers.
The former St Kevin’s Boys and Shamrock Rovers player is a past pupil of Milford NS, Castletroy Gaelscoil and Castletroy College. He also previously played GAA with Ballybricken and Monaleen clubs. Ryan completed his Leaving Cert in June of last year at Ashfield College in Dublin.
Ryan tasted tasted double national underage league success at U17 and U19 level with Shamrock Rovers.
The talented Limerick teenager has represented the Rep of Ireland at under-age level up through the age grades.
